Output 867097cd541d897401d688d3f1d32eb2c0d1b579c7ec44b6cff2f1aa63dd9169:5

value
19687527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8936ba6d87cea7a323ab27e5543321d7a2f20e OP_EQUAL
address
37JPX2UARcCyZd7x9afnCGvb1g45XA8d6m
transaction
867097cd541d897401d688d3f1d32eb2c0d1b579c7ec44b6cff2f1aa63dd9169
spent
true